Fault detection and a differential fault analysis countermeasure for the Montgomery power ladder in elliptic curve cryptography

被引:2
|
作者
Vasyltsov, Ihor [2 ]
Saldamli, Gokay [1 ]
机构
[1] Bogazici Univ, MIS Dept, TR-34342 Istanbul, Turkey
[2] Samsung Elect, Syst LSI, Yongin 449711, Gyeonggi Do, South Korea
关键词
Montgomery power ladder; Elliptic curve cryptography; Side-channel attack; Countermeasure; ATTACKS; RSA;
D O I
10.1016/j.mcm.2011.06.017
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
We describe a new fault detection method in elliptic curve scalar multiplication deployments using the Montgomery power ladder. An attack based on the arithmetic properties of the Montgomery power ladder algorithm could be avoided by a clearly defined differential fault analysis countermeasure that is extremely efficient against sign-change fault analysis over prime fields. In order to give a complete analysis of the proposed countermeasure, our mathematical models are supported by some software routines implementing various schemes over prime and binary fields. According to our analysis, we report that the performance of the proposed countermeasure meets the theoretical bounds for the checking-at-the-end method, and requires reasonable overhead for the others. (C) 2011 Elsevier Ltd. All rights reserved.
引用
收藏
页码:256 / 267
页数:12
相关论文
共 50 条
  • [1] Fault attack on elliptic curve with Montgomery ladder implementation
    Fouque, Pierre-Alain
    Real, Denis
    Lercier, Reynald
    Valette, Fredric
    [J]. FDTC 2008: FAULT DIAGNOSIS AND TOLERANCE IN CRYPTOGRAPHY, PROCEEDINGS, 2008, : 92 - +
  • [2] Securing the Elliptic Curve Montgomery Ladder Against Fault Attacks
    Ebeid, Nevine
    Lambert, Rob
    [J]. PROCEEDINGS OF THE 2009 WORKSHOP ON FAULT DIAGNOSIS AND TOLERANCE IN CRYPTOGRAPHY (FDTC 2009), 2009, : 46 - +
  • [3] Securing the Elliptic Curve Montgomery Ladder Against Fault Attacks
    Ebeid, Nevine
    Lambert, Rob
    [J]. 2009 WORKSHOP ON FAULT DIAGNOSIS AND TOLERANCE IN CRYPTOGRAPHY (FDTC 2009), 2009, : 46 - 50
  • [4] Residue Number System as a Side Channel and Fault Injection Attack countermeasure in Elliptic Curve Cryptography
    Fournaris, Apostolos P.
    Papachristodoulou, Louiza
    Batina, Lejla
    Sklavos, Nicolas
    [J]. 2016 11TH IEEE INTERNATIONAL CONFERENCE ON DESIGN & TECHNOLOGY OF INTEGRATED SYSTEMS IN NANOSCALE ERA (DTIS), 2016,
  • [5] An Efficient Fault Detection Method for Elliptic Curve Scalar Multiplication Montgomery Algorithm
    Bedoui, Mouna
    Bouallegue, Belgacem
    Hamdi, Belgacem
    Machhout, Mohsen
    [J]. 2019 IEEE INTERNATIONAL CONFERENCE ON DESIGN & TEST OF INTEGRATED MICRO & NANO-SYSTEMS (DTS), 2019,
  • [6] Smart Card Fault Attacks on Elliptic Curve Cryptography
    Ling, Jie
    King, Brian
    [J]. 2013 IEEE 56TH INTERNATIONAL MIDWEST SYMPOSIUM ON CIRCUITS AND SYSTEMS (MWSCAS), 2013, : 1255 - 1258
  • [7] Differential Fault Attack on Montgomery Ladder and in the Presence of Scalar Randomization
    Russon, Andy
    [J]. PROGRESS IN CRYPTOLOGY, INDOCRYPT 2021, 2021, 13143 : 287 - 310
  • [8] A Novel and Efficient countermeasure against Power Analysis Attacks using Elliptic Curve Cryptography
    Prabu, M.
    Shanmugalakshmi, R.
    [J]. IN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2010, 1 (02) : 17 - 21
  • [9] Novel fault attack resistant architecture for elliptic curve cryptography
    Zode, Pravin
    Deshmukh, Raghavendra
    [J]. MICROPROCESSORS AND MICROSYSTEMS, 2021, 84
  • [10] Fault Attacks on the Montgomery Powering Ladder
    Schmidt, Joern-Marc
    Medwed, Marcel
    [J]. INFORMATION SECURITY AND CRYPTOLOGY - ICISC 2010, 2011, 6829 : 396 - 406